复合式培训模式在实习生病历首页书写教学中的应用研究
Research on the Application of Compound Training mode in the Teaching of Writing the First Page of Medi-cal Records for Interns
摘要
Abstract
Objective To explore the application effect of the lecture on the writing norms of the first page of acute stroke medical records and Peking University Medical In-formation System in the teaching of interns Methods 150 clinical medicine interns in our hospital from July 2021 to July 2024 were randomly divided into the observation group(acute stroke medical record home page writing standard lecture+Peking University medical information system training),the control group 1(routine training),control group 2(routine training+Peking University med-ical information system training),with 50 cases in each group.The learning initiative,post competency,medical re-cord writing error rate and training satisfaction were com-pared among the groups.Results Comparison of the total incidence of writing errors/irregularities on the first page of medical records among the three groups,the observation group<the control group 1,2(P<0.05).After training,the active learning scale(ALS)and post competency scores of the three groups were compared,the observation group>the control group 2>the control group 1(P<0.05).The training satisfaction of the observation group was higher than that of the control group 1 and 2(P<0.05).Conclusion The lecture on the writing norms of the first page of acute stroke medical records combined with the Peking University Medical Information System can ef-fectively improve the writing quality of acute stroke medi-cal records and the training satisfaction of interns.关键词
